For those of you who don’t know, wingsuit flying is a sport where a person can glide through the air using a special jumpsuit (wingsuit). The wingsuit features added surface areas by having additional cloth between the legs and under the arms which makes the free fall towards the earth more efficient. Basically, if you wanted to kill yourself by jumping off a high-rise building and wanted to enjoy the view for a longer period of time, then a wingsuit is the way to do it.
